So an optimistic UI in this case might guess at as to what that data is or if it didn't already know what it should be from the server, It would maybe put put those like, you know, you could do a loading state that has like those pulsating gray images that tell you like something's about to go in here. So that would sort of be considered an optimistic UI. A more optimistic UI is if the JavaScript client side front end knows fully what should go in there because it contains its own model of all the business logic and all the, essentially what you would get from the database inside it.

Lazarus:

And this is sort of what a lot of react style view Vue JS style apps do. You front load all that information, you front load all that JSON and everything, so that when you click on this drop down it doesn't need to get it from the server. Or if it does need to get it from the server, it already has a guess. It already has a local version of what it thinks that will be. And then maybe it goes to the server to verify.

Lazarus:

And that's kind of the optimistic idea. It it's optimistic that it has the right information, but it still needs to check. The more common version of the optimistic UI is like a Trello board. You may have seen that you've got, let's say 4 columns to do, working on, to review, and completed. And you just create a to do on the to do.

Lazarus:

It's a little card. When you're ready to start working on it you move that card, you just click and drag that card over to the, working on column. Right? If you just let the server side do that, you know, you can have a drag thing, but you then need to wait until the server comes back with a response and redraws the page to show that it's there. So after you click and drag, when you let go, your little box disappears while the server request happens.

Lazarus:

Let's say that's a slow server request, then it comes back and then it puts it in the right place. That's not an optimistic UI. That's just server side rendering. You know, I would call it, you know, h t m x kind of, that's how you would probably do it by default without a lot of thought put into it. You would just, you know, have that set up.

Lazarus:

Optimistic UI would be everything is on the client side. When you drag that over it just in the dom moves it over. Right. It's just there. Now it's in the new dom.

Lazarus:

It's actually a virtual dom that it puts it into. But you are in that when you drag it, it's there, and and then it sends your server request to say, okay, put this there and then, you know, basically, optimistically, it's gonna work. It's fine. You need to move this from one place to another. If the server says, no, actually, you know, you're timed out or there's something wrong with your authentication or that to do card has been deleted since the last time you checked, then you'll get maybe some error message and then the card will have to go back to where it was.

Lazarus:

But most of the time, it's just gonna send a request to the server saying here's the thing that's supposed to happen. Did that work? The answer is gonna be, yeah. Sure. That's fine.

Lazarus:

So it's basically just sending like a verification after the fact. But for the user experience, you just clicked it and dragged it, moved it over, everything worked fine. You never see the server stuff happening in the background. You never see the check. So to you it feels like, that's all happening, you know, real time, front end.

Lazarus:

That's a good experience. And this is really like this is the core of a lot of this is why the front end, first kind of team exists. Like they feel like this is the ideal UI, all this optimistic UI. Is that incompatible because with this kind of hypermedia as the engine of application state, that hate us or whatever you wanna call it, hate us. That's the idea that you can't do something that is not part of your DOM.

Lazarus:

So, you know, your DOM is your state. That's your application. There's no hidden things. There's no background virtual model that's actually deciding what's happening. Your DOM is the application state.

Lazarus:

So does optimism make sense if your DOM is the app application state? Do you want to have, you know, in that example of a Trello board, you know, you drag your thing over, you now have sitting there, the Dom now has a card in the wrong place. Like your server is your source of truth. Your server decides what should be where, what actions you should have. Right?

Lazarus:

So do you want is it okay to have just a piece of your dom that might have buttons in it, it might have an edit button, Is it okay to just have that exist, in place without it being verified by the server? You know, if you start clicking that and doing stuff, it's optimistic. Sure. But what if it's wrong? Right?

And maybe it's only works because it's draggable, you know, if if you do something like save. Yeah. Okay. So here here's a more difficult example. You have a form and you click save, and you want it to just, like, you know, if you're using all client side stuff, you can optimistically assume everything in that form is gonna save correctly and go over to your list of items, you know, your your to do list or whatever.

Lazarus:

So the problem with this is you cannot do the same thing that we just did. We're draggable. We just assume all the HTML's the same. If you're saving a form, those are like inputs and text areas and drop downs and selects. That's gonna be a totally different format than your visual, you know, once it's been saved.

Lazarus:

So you cannot just take the same HTML and move it over. So what could you do if you had some sort of optimism in HTMLX? You could let's just say I'm just like thinking here. But what if you defined a format or maybe not so much a format, but a a temp yeah. You could define a template, I guess.

Lazarus:

An invisible template. So you know, you you have an empty div and your optimism plugin, h, you know, h t m x optimism, you could as you could say which template to look at. You give that template an ID. Call it like optimistic template, new item or something. So this is a format, a a and then you'd have to have, you know, place holders in that template for the different inputs, for the different selects.

Lazarus:

So how you define those, maybe a little tricky, but maybe you just put a little JSON thing that's like or maybe there's some defaults, you know, you you give your template the ID's, or the name, or or some sort of attribute on each on each, field or on each, div or or element in there that matches to something on that form. And so what it will do is when you click save, if you have this h t m x optimism, plugin or, extension or whatever, it you know, you define h x optimism template equals, and then you have your ID for the template. It looks at that, fills all of it, and, like, copies that HTML and puts that I guess you'd have to go for a target as well, so your your optimistic target puts that where it should go. So immediately when you click it fills out that template, puts it in place, then it does its regular h t m x thing and gets the response back and fills your, you know, fills it out for real. And so the goal would be to have your template match exactly what it's going to be when it comes back, so that, ideally, you would not see any, you know, blip or there would be there would be no apparent delay.

Lazarus:

And that's the goal with optimism, you know, no apparent delay.
